MassMutual Introduces Variable Annuity For Nonprofit Retirement Plans

NU Online News Service, July 2, 3:05 p.m. – Massachusetts Mutual Life Insurance Company, Springfield, Mass., has introduced MassMutual Artistry, a variable annuity designed for the 403(b) retirement plan market.

Schools, hospitals and other nonprofit organizations often set up 403(b) plans in place of the 401(k) retirement plans available from for-profit employers.

The Artistry annuity offers a choice of 39 investment options from 15 money managers, including Fidelity Investments, Boston, and MassMutual’s own money management subsidiaries.

The annuity also offers a fixed account option.

MassMutual issues the annuity in New York. A subsidiary, C.M. Life Insurance Company, Hartford, issues the annuity in all other states.
